How good robot vacuum cleaner Vacuum and Mop Cleaners Work: A Symphony of Sensors and Smart Technology
Robot vacuum and mop cleaners are sophisticated gadgets that make use of a combination of sensing units, algorithms, and mechanical parts to browse and tidy floorings autonomously. While the particular innovation may differ between designs and brand names, the fundamental concepts stay consistent.
At their core, these robotics rely on a suite of sensing units to perceive their environment. These sensing units can consist of:
Bump sensing units: Detect crashes with obstacles, prompting the robot to alter instructions.Cliff sensing units: Prevent the robot from falling down stairs or ledges by finding drops in elevation.Wall sensors: Allow the robot to follow walls and edges for thorough cleaning.Optical and infrared sensors: Used for navigation, mapping, and object detection, assisting the robot develop efficient cleaning paths and prevent barriers.Gyroscope and accelerometer: Help the robot track its movement and orientation, adding to precise navigation and location protection.
These sensors feed information to an onboard computer that processes information and directs the robot’s movement. Lots of modern robot vacuum and mops make use of sophisticated navigation technologies such as:
Random Bounce Navigation: Older and simpler models typically employ this approach, moving arbitrarily up until they experience a challenge, then changing instructions. While less efficient, they can still cover an area over time.Methodical Navigation: More advanced robotics use methodical cleaning patterns, such as zig-zag or spiral motions, to guarantee more total and effective coverage.Smart Mapping: High-end designs feature innovative mapping capabilities, frequently using LiDAR (Light Detection and Ranging) or vSLAM (visual Simultaneous Localization and Mapping). These innovations allow robots to create detailed maps of the home, allowing them to tidy particular rooms, set virtual boundaries, and learn the layout for enhanced cleaning routes.
The cleaning process itself involves 2 main functions: vacuuming and mopping.
Vacuuming: Robot vacuums use brushes to loosen particles from the floor and an effective suction motor to draw dirt, dust, pet hair, and other particles into a dustbin. Various brush types and suction levels deal with numerous floor types, from difficult floorings to carpets.Mopping: Robot mops typically feature a water tank and a mopping pad. The robot gives water onto the pad, which then cleans the floor. Some models provide vibrating or oscillating mopping pads for more reliable stain removal. Various mopping modes and water circulation settings are often offered to fit different floor types and cleaning requirements.

Browsing the Options: Types of Robot Vacuum and Mops
The robot vacuum and mop market varies, offering numerous designs with various performances. Here’s a general categorization to assist understand the alternatives:
Robot Vacuums Only: These are dedicated vacuuming robotics that focus entirely on dry cleaning. They are typically more inexpensive and frequently use robust vacuuming performance.2-in-1 Robot Vacuum and Mops: These flexible gadgets integrate both vacuuming and mopping performances. They provide benefit and space-saving benefits, though mopping performance might be less intensive than devoted robot mops in some designs.Devoted Robot Mops: These robots are specifically created for mopping tough floors. They frequently feature more sophisticated mopping systems, such as vibrating pads and accurate water giving control, for effective damp cleaning.Self-Emptying Robot Vacuums: These premium designs come with a charging base that also operates as a dustbin. When the robot’s dustbin is full, it instantly clears into the bigger base dustbin, significantly minimizing manual emptying frequency.Smart Robot Vacuums and Mops: These sophisticated robots are geared up with smart functions like Wi-Fi connection, smartphone app control, voice assistant integration (e.g., Alexa, Google Assistant), room mapping, and virtual no-go zones.

Maintaining Your Robot Vacuum and Mop: Ensuring Longevity and Performance
To guarantee your robot vacuum and mop runs efficiently and lasts for several years, routine maintenance is important. Secret upkeep jobs consist of:
Emptying the Dustbin: Empty the dustbin routinely, preferably after each cleaning cycle, to preserve optimal suction performance.Cleaning or Replacing Filters: Clean or change filters according to the producer’s recommendations. Blocked filters decrease suction and cleaning efficiency.Cleaning Brushes: Remove hair and debris tangled in the brushes routinely. Some designs include tools specifically developed for brush cleaning.Cleaning Mop Pads: Wash or replace mop pads after each mopping cycle to maintain hygiene and cleaning effectiveness.Cleaning Sensors: Periodically clean the robot’s sensing units with a soft, dry fabric to guarantee accurate navigation and barrier detection.Looking for Obstructions: Regularly check the robot’s path for prospective obstructions like cables or little things that could get twisted.
By following these easy maintenance actions, you can ensure your robot vacuum and mop continues to offer trustworthy and effective cleaning for years to come.

Q2: Can robot vacuum and mops clean up all kinds of floorings?
The majority of robot vacuums and mops are developed to clean hard floors like hardwood, tile, laminate, and linoleum. Lots of models can likewise manage low-pile carpets and rugs. However, incredibly luxurious or high-pile carpets might pose obstacles for some robots. Constantly examine the maker’s requirements regarding floor types.
Q3: Do robot vacuum and mops need Wi-Fi to run?
Standard robot vacuum and mops without smart functions can operate without Wi-Fi. Nevertheless, models with Wi-Fi connection deal improved features like smartphone app control, scheduling, space mapping, and voice assistant combination. Wi-Fi is essential to use these smart performances.
Q4: How long do robot vacuum and mops normally last?
The lifespan of a robot vacuum and mop depends upon use, upkeep, and the quality of the gadget. With appropriate maintenance, a great quality robot vacuum and mop can last for several years, normally varying from 3 to 5 years or perhaps longer.
Q5: Are robot vacuum and mops loud?
Robot vacuums and mops normally produce less noise than standard vacuum cleaners. Sound levels differ between models, however lots of are designed to run silently enough not to be disruptive during regular home activities.
Q6: Can robot vacuum and mops tidy pet hair successfully?
Yes, lots of robot vacuums are specifically designed for pet hair elimination. Try to find models with features like strong suction, tangle-free brushes, and larger dustbins, which are particularly reliable at choosing up pet hair and dander.
Q7: What takes place if a robot vacuum and mop gets stuck?
Modern robot vacuum and mops are equipped with sensors and barrier avoidance technology to reduce getting stuck. However, they might occasionally get stuck on loose cable televisions, small objects, or in tight corners. Lots of designs will automatically stop and send out an alert if they get stuck.
Q8: Do I need to prepare my house before using a robot vacuum and mop?
It’s suggested to declutter floorings by getting rid of small objects, cables, and loose items that could obstruct the robot or get tangled in the brushes. Tucking away chair legs and raising curtains can likewise enhance cleaning efficiency.
Q9: Can robot vacuum and mops climb over limits?
The majority of robot vacuum and mops can climb over low limits, typically around 0.5 to 0.75 inches. However, greater thresholds might prevent them from moving in between rooms. Examine the producer’s requirements for limit climbing ability.
